A Definition of Data Protection Officer

An information defense police officer (DPO) is an enterprise safety and security management function needed by the General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R). Data security officers are in charge of supervising a company's information defense method and its execution to guarantee compliance with GDPR needs. Which Companies Need Data Protection Officers?

GDPR was presented by the European Parliament, the European Council, and also the European Commission to enhance and enhance data security for European Union people. It asks for the obligatory consultation of a DPO at every organization that refines or stores individual information for EU residents. DPOs have to be, "designated for all public authorities, and where the core activities of the controller or the processor include 'routine as well as organized surveillance of information topics on a big range' or where the entity conducts large-scale processing of 'unique categories of personal data,'" such as race, ethnic background, or spiritual ideas.

The language of GDPR shows that the size of an organization is not what requires the demand for a DPO, however instead the dimension and also range of information taking care of. Sadly, GDPR does not particularly specify what they think about to be "big range" data handling. The information security officer is a necessary duty for all firms that accumulate or process EU citizens' personal information, under Article 37 of GDPR. DPOs are in charge of informing the firm and also its staff members concerning conformity, training personnel associated with information handling, as well as carrying out normal security audits. DPOs also offer as the factor of contact in between the business and also any Supervisory Authorities (SAs) that look after activities associated to data.

The GDPR does not include a certain listing of DPO credentials, but Article 37 does require a data security police officer to have "professional understanding of information security legislation as well as practices." The guideline likewise specifies that the DPO's competence must line up with the organization's data processing procedures and also the level pop over to these guys of information defense required for what is refined by data controllers and also data processors.

DPOs may be a controller or cpu's staff member, as well as great section on their site relevant organizations may utilize the same person to oversee information security collectively, as long as the DPO is easily accessible to anyone at those associated organizations. It is needed that the DPO's information is released openly as well as supplied to all governing oversight companies.

Information Protection Officers should not have a dispute of rate of interest, meaning that the DPO should not have any kind of existing obligations or obligations that remain in problem with their monitoring responsibilities. A lawful guidance that might stand for the firm in a lawful proceeding would certainly be considered to have a dispute of interest, and also for that reason would certainly not be qualified to serve as the DPO Companies that violate this demand may go through penalties up to EU$ 10 million or two percent of the company's around the world turn over, whichever is better.
